Default Roundup Decimal

Hi

I'll see if I can explain my problem

I have the following formula in a cell =SUM(O22)/(I22-J22) which
equals the amount of 12.11 (It's actually 12.11368…I only use 2
decimals)

Now I want to multiply the above cell with the 12.11 with another cell
containing 494.00 and the result ought to be 5 982,34 but instead I
get 5 983.00!

All cells involved are formated as currency with 2 decimals

Any suggestions - Tia
